Output 94742554ec356057cf4d25f3c55c5d300d799c163c5b68fef7066e53b219f273:7

value
517580
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d594714a90d6d58f0cce16471068fcd3f2a7d19 OP_EQUAL
address
3G2zxnHe79QwWTKUMiV3EDf8bNqm9SzzhE
transaction
94742554ec356057cf4d25f3c55c5d300d799c163c5b68fef7066e53b219f273
confirmations
514311
spent
true